New board announces ‘agreement in principle’ for return of former CEO after campaign by staff and investors to have him brought back

Sam Altman is set to make a return as chief executive of OpenAI after the ChatGPT developer said it had “reached an agreement in principle” for his reinstatement.

The San Francisco-based company made the announcement after days of corporate drama in the wake of Altman’s surprise sacking on Friday. Nearly all of OpenAI’s 750-strong workforce has threatened to quit unless the board overseeing the business brought back Altman and then quit immediately afterwards.
